@charset "UTF-8";
/* Stone */

/*---------------------------------------------------- */
/* h2 */
/*---------------------------------------------------- */
/* .page-title {
	padding: 0 0 20px 0;
	margin: 0;
	width: 400px;
	height: auto;
}

.page-title h2 {
	padding: 27px 0 0 0;
	margin: 0;
	width: 400px;
	height: 0;
	background: url(../../images/stone/page-title.png) no-repeat 0 0;
	overflow: hidden;
} */

/*---------------------------------------------------- */
/* h3 */
/*---------------------------------------------------- */
.category-title {
	padding: 16px 0 16px 0;
	margin: 0;
	width: 1280px;
	height: auto;
	border-top: solid 1px #c1c0bf;
	border-bottom: solid 1px #c1c0bf;
}

.category-title h3 {
	padding: 0;
	margin: 0 0 0 10px;
	font-size: 17px;
	font-weight: normal;
	line-height: 120%;
}

/*---------------------------------------------------- */
/* Waku */
/*---------------------------------------------------- */
.waku-photo {
	margin: 0;
	width: 1280px;
	height: auto;
	overflow: hidden;
}

.waku-photo .photo-left {
	margin: 0;
	width: 810px;
	height: auto;
	float: left;
}

.waku-photo .photo-right {
	margin: 0;
	width: 440px;
	height: auto;
	float: right;
}

.waku-photo .photo-left2 {
	margin: 0;
	width: 635px;
	height: auto;
	float: left;
}

.waku-photo .photo-right2 {
	margin: 0;
	width: 635px;
	height: auto;
	float: right;
}

/*---------------------------------------------------- */
/* Photo */
/*---------------------------------------------------- */
.photo-stone001 {
    margin: 0;
	width: 440px;
	height: auto;
}

.photo-stone002 {
    margin: 0;
	width: 635px;
	height: auto;
}

.photo-stone003 {
    margin: 0;
	width: 635px;
	height: auto;
}

/*---------------------------------------------------- */
/* P */
/*---------------------------------------------------- */
.text-stone {
	margin: 0;
	height: auto;
}

.text-stone p {
	padding: 0;
	margin: 0;
	font-size: 14px;
	font-weight: normal;
	line-height: 160%;
}













